int flag_lookup (const char *name, const struct flag_type *flag_table)
{
    int flag;

    for (flag = 0; flag_table[flag].name != NULL; flag++)
    {
	if (LOWER(name[0]) == LOWER(flag_table[flag].name[0])
	&&  !str_prefix(name,flag_table[flag].name))
	    return flag_table[flag].bit;
    }

    return NO_FLAG;
}

/**LOOKUP.C Clan Code by Fear_Phantom**/
/*
 * replace clan_lookup with this one
 */
int clan_lookup (const char *name)
{
	/* clan data structure pointer */
	CLAN_DATA *cIndex;

	/* loop through clans */
	for(cIndex=CLhead; cIndex != NULL; cIndex=cIndex->CLnext)
	{
		if (LOWER(name[0]) == LOWER(cIndex->short_name[0])
		&&  !str_prefix( name,cIndex->short_name))
		    return cIndex->clan_number;
	}

	/* no clan by that name */
   	return 0;
}


int position_lookup (const char *name)
{
   int pos;

   for (pos = 0; position_table[pos].name != NULL; pos++)
   {
	if (LOWER(name[0]) == LOWER(position_table[pos].name[0])
	&&  !str_prefix(name,position_table[pos].name))
	    return pos;
   }

   return -1;
}

int sex_lookup (const char *name)
{
   int sex;

   for (sex = 0; sex_table[sex].name != NULL; sex++)
   {
	if (LOWER(name[0]) == LOWER(sex_table[sex].name[0])
	&&  !str_prefix(name,sex_table[sex].name))
	    return sex;
   }

   return -1;
}

int size_lookup (const char *name)
{
   int size;

   for ( size = 0; size_table[size].name != NULL; size++)
   {
        if (LOWER(name[0]) == LOWER(size_table[size].name[0])
        &&  !str_prefix( name,size_table[size].name))
            return size;
   }

   return -1;
}

int race_lookup (const char *name)
{
	RACE_INFO_DATA *ri;

	for(ri=RIhead; ri != NULL; ri=ri->RInext)
	{
		if (LOWER(name[0]) == LOWER(ri->name[0])
		&&  !str_prefix( name,ri->name))
		    return ri->race_number;
	}

   	return 0;
}


int item_lookup(const char *name)
{
    int type;

    for (type = 0; item_table[type].name != NULL; type++)
    {
        if (LOWER(name[0]) == LOWER(item_table[type].name[0])
        &&  !str_prefix(name,item_table[type].name))
            return item_table[type].type;
    }

    return -1;
}

int liq_lookup (const char *name)
{
    int liq;

    for ( liq = 0; liq_table[liq].liq_name != NULL; liq++)
    {
	if (LOWER(name[0]) == LOWER(liq_table[liq].liq_name[0])
	&& !str_prefix(name,liq_table[liq].liq_name))
	    return liq;
    }

    return -1;
}

HELP_DATA * help_lookup( char *keyword )
{
	HELP_DATA *pHelp;
	char temp[MIL], argall[MIL];

	argall[0] = '\0';

	while (keyword[0] != '\0' )
	{
		keyword = one_argument(keyword, temp);
		if (argall[0] != '\0')
			strcat(argall," ");
		strcat(argall, temp);
	}

	for ( pHelp = help_first; pHelp != NULL; pHelp = pHelp->next )
		if ( is_name( argall, pHelp->keyword ) )
			return pHelp;

	return NULL;
}

HELP_AREA * had_lookup( char *arg )
{
	HELP_AREA * temp;
	extern HELP_AREA * had_list;

	for ( temp = had_list; temp; temp = temp->next )
		if ( !str_cmp( arg, temp->filename ) )
			return temp;

	return NULL;
}
